Description

De-identification is the removal of identifying information from data. Several US laws, regulations and policies specify that data should be de-identified prior to sharing as a control to protect the privacy of the data subjects. In recent years researchers have shown that some de-identified data can sometimes be re-identified. This document summarizes roughly two decades of de-identification research, discusses current practices, and presents opportunities for future research.
